Bluegill fishing on Michigan Upper Peninsula Inland Lakes

There are literally hundreds upon hundreds of great bluegill fishing opportunities on Michigan's Upper Peninsula inland lakes- many of them are open all year around and many are remote, hidden back country lakes that are hardly fished at all.

Michigan U.P. Bluegill Fishing

Welcome to Bluegill Fishing Country

Whether you venture the west, central or the eastern Upper Peninsula, you can easily encounter good to excellent "clear water" bluegill fishing if you know where to go and how to find them.

Most lakes are abundant with them. You can easily fish for them from the shorelines if you know how and where to locate them.

The best way to locate bluegill is using a boat or canoe. In the winter you can catch them ice fishing through the ice. There's no doubt about it... pound per pound, bluegills offer up some real-time angling enjoyment and oftentimes big rewards. Bluegills are an excellent table fare eating. They are the perfect catch for a campsite fish fry.

Big bluegills are not in short supply if you know where to scout for them. Late spring to early summer is the most productive season for big bluegill fishing in Michigan's Upper Peninsula. Bluegills become more active as weeds and weed cover begin to develop and water temps begin to rise- sparking a frantic feeding frenzy in anticipation to their spawning rituals.

Where there's weeds, you'll find bluegills. Where there's structure you'll find bluegills. However, where you find weeds adjacent to deep water access... you'll find big bluegills. That's where you want to fish for the big ones.

 

Bluegill Fishing Equipment

Big Bluegill caught on a jig You can catch bluegills in a variety of ways... spin fishing for bluegills is one way in which you use a spinning reel and rod to cast bait items such as worms, crawlers, wax worms or even small minnows.

Some fishermen rely entirely on using a long cane pole with as much as 8 to 12 feet of monofilament attached to the end- along with a light weight and bobber. This type of fishing is great for fishing from a dock or from a shoreline point to deep water.

Another and most rewarding way to catch bluegills is with a fly rod. Fishing bluegills with a fly rod is most challenging and an ideal way to learn and to master fly fishing techniques before you venture out on lakes and streams for trout fishing. Summer time is the best time to catch bluegills with a fly rod- primarily because bait presentations (fly patterns) are plentiful. Be careful however... fly fishing for bluegills is highly addictive.
